What we need from clients

Sideline Swing is a large group with a sound to match, so it is important to take these into consideration when having us play.

Our sound carries, so the whole neighbourhood will be listening along, especially for outdoor events. This can be a real bonus when trying to draw people into a public event.

Indoors, where sound gets trapped, we can’t easily play “quiet background music”, so conversation will be affected. If you want some relaxed jazz playing quietly while you eat dinner, we may be too loud for you. You can either arrange the tables so they are further from the band, or save us for when everyone is ready to get up and dance.

We generally need a minimum of 9 square metres (we prefer a minimum of 3m x 3m, but the bigger the better) for the musicians while they are performing, plus some nearby offstage storage space for cases and personal items. If your stage or performance area is smaller or has a different layout, let us know and we’ll see how it can be made to work. We have performed in some very small spaces, but these may require special handling.

We have everything we need to perform, including a PA system and amplifiers for the rhythm section, vocals and soloist microphones. We require access to power points for these. We can provide a generator, if required. This will be noisy and will need additional space, so need to be factored in to your staging plans. If you have a keyboard, drumkit, amplifiers, or a PA already provided (by the venue or another group), we are happy to use this if it is appropriate for our sound requirements.

If you have your own MC, would like to use our PA for speeches, or to play music at other times in the event, we can usually oblige. We are also happy to work with other performers you may have at your event, to make transitions as seamless as possible. If you won’t have a stage manager coordinating, just let us know if someone else will be playing before or after us and we can even liaise directly with them.

For outdoor events, we can provide out own gazebo for shade, and will usually store our cases behind or beside the performance area (unless another space is provided). We like to keep the performance area tidy, both for safety and visual appeal, so having somewhere to discretely stash our cases is always welcome.

We will usually have 3-4 vehicles needing parking/access to the stage area for gear being set up and packed down. The PA is very heavy, so elevator and/or ramp access is preferred if we will not be on the ground floor, and we need wide enough access for carrying the PA and cases in all venues.

Unless you specifically request shorter sets, Sideline Swing perform in blocks of roughly 45-50 minutes per hour of stage time. So for a 2 hour event, the band would usually play for 50 minutes, then take a break of approximately 15-20 minutes before performing for another 50 minutes. We will put some music through the PA during the break. This break is also a great time for speeches or announcements. Some form of light refreshments during the break (even just something to drink and packet of bickies to share) will help the band keep their energy up for the next set.
